• 제목/요약/키워드: 재생 커널 방법

검색결과 7건 처리시간 0.018초

무요소법을 이용한 균열진전 문제의 형상 최적설계 (Shape Design Optimization of Crack Propagation Problems Using Meshfree Methods)

  • 김재현;하승현;조선호
    • 한국전산구조공학회논문집
    • /
    • 제27권5호
    • /
    • pp.337-343
    • /
    • 2014
  • 본 논문에서는 재생 커널 기법을 사용하여 혼합모드 균열진전 문제에 대한 연속체 기반의 형상 설계민감도 해석을 수행하였다. 재생 커널 기법은 기존의 유한요소법과 달리 요소망을 재구성할 필요가 없어, 커널 함수의 연속성을 증가시켰을 때 높은 정밀도의 형상함수를 얻을 수 있다는 장점을 가지고 있다. 균열선단 주변에서 J-적분을 수행하기 위해 선형탄성 조건이 고려되었다. 변위장과 응력 확대 계수의 설계변수에 대한 감도해석을 위하여 물질도함수를 도입하였으며 직접 미분법보다 효율적인 애조인 방법을 사용하여 설계민감도를 유도하였다. 수치 예제들을 통해서 재생 커널 기법을 이용한 균열진전 해석결과의 타당성을 확인하였으며 애조인 방법을 이용한 형상 설계민감도 해석 결과를 유한차분법과 비교하여 매우 정확하고 효율적인 결과를 얻을 수 있음을 알 수 있었다. 이를 바탕으로 간단한 모델에 대하여 형상 최적설계를 수행하여 균열이 발생될 수 있는 구조물에 대해서 균열에 의한 피해를 최소화할 수 있도록 균열을 제어할 수 있는 최적의 형상을 도출하였다.

실시간 운영체제인 Q+에서 작동하는 미디어 재생기 개발 (The Development of Q+ Media Player)

  • 조창식;마평수
    • 한국정보처리학회:학술대회논문집
    • /
    • 한국정보처리학회 2000년도 추계학술발표논문집 (상)
    • /
    • pp.371-374
    • /
    • 2000
  • ADSL, ISDN 등과 같은 초고속 인터넷 접속 서비스가 제공됨에 따라 일반 가정에서 인터넷을 이용하여 영화나 음악을 감상하는 것이 가능하게 되었다. 또한 인터넷의 발전과 함께 정보가전의 활용 범위가 확대됨에 따라 다양한 서비스를 제공하는 정보가전의 개발이 가속화되고 있으며, 정보가전을 위한 운영체제 개발 또한 중요한 목표가 되고 있다. 본 논문에서는 실시간 운영체제인 Q+에서 작동하는 미디어 재생기에 대하여 설명한다. 단말장치가 지원하는 미디어로는 MP3, MPEG-1, MPEG-4 이며, Q+의 커널 및 라이브러를 이용하여 구현하였다. 미디어 재생기는 서버와 Delivery Manager, 클라이언트로 구성된다. 서버는 멀티미디어 파일에 대한 스트리밍 서비스를 수행하며 Delivery Manager 는 서버와 클라이언트의 네트워크 투명성을 제공한다. 본 논문에서는 미디어 재생기를 Q+로 구현하면서 운영체제가 달라지면서 변경되는 프로그래밍 상의 기법 및 미디어 재생기의 성능 향상 방법에 대하여 설명한다.

  • PDF

Q+ 실시간 운영체제에서 동작하는 미디어 재생기의 구현 (The Implementation of a Media Player on Q+ Real-time Operating System)

  • 조창식;마평수
    • 한국정보처리학회논문지
    • /
    • 제7권11호
    • /
    • pp.3509-3518
    • /
    • 2000
  • ADSL, ISDN 등과 같은 초고속 인터넷 접속 서비스가 발전함에 따라 일반 가정에서 인터넷을 이용하여 영화나 음악을 감상하는 것이 가능하게 되었다. 또한 정보가전의 활용 범위가 확대됨에 따라 다양한 서비스를 제공하는 정보가전의 개발이 가속화되고 있으며 정보가전을 위한 운영체제 개발 및 실시간 운영체제를 탑재한 단말장치에서의 스트리밍 서비스가 중요한 개발 목표가 되고 있다. 본 논문에서는 실시간 운영체제인 Q+에서 동작하는 미디어 재생기의 구현 기술과 경험에 대하여 설명한다. 미디어 재생기는 서버에서 전송된 MP3, MPEG-1, MPEG-4 데이터를 소프트웨어로 디코딩하여 사용자에게 보여준다. 미디어 재생기는 저가의 CPU가 장착된 디지털 TV 셋탑박스에서 동작하며, Q+ 운영체제의 커널 및 라이브러리를 이용하여 구현되었다. 따라서 하드웨어와 실시간 운영체제의 특성을 고려한 프로그래밍 기법 및 성능 향상 기법이 요구된다. 본 논문에서는 Q+ 운영체제에서 동작하는 미디어 재생기 구현과 관련하여 프로그래밍 상의 기법 및 미디어 재생기의 성능 향상 방법에 대하여 설명한다.

  • PDF

머신러닝 기반 페로브스카이트 태양전지 광흡수층 박막 최적화를 위한 연구 (A Study on Optimization of Perovskite Solar Cell Light Absorption Layer Thin Film Based on Machine Learning)

  • 하재준;이준혁;오주영;이동근
    • 한국콘텐츠학회논문지
    • /
    • 제22권7호
    • /
    • pp.55-62
    • /
    • 2022
  • 페로브스카이트 태양전지는 4차 산업혁명으로 사물인터넷, 가상환경 등의 증가에 따른 전력 수요가 급증하면서 점진적으로 고갈되어가는 석유, 석탄, 천연가스 등의 화석연료를 대체할 태양에너지, 풍력, 수력, 해양에너지, 바이오에너지, 수소에너지 등의 신재생 에너지 분야에서 연구가 활발한 부분이다. 페로브스카이트 태양전지는 페로브스카이트 구조를 가진 유-무기 하이브리드 물질을 사용하는 태양전지 소자로 고효율, 저가의 용액 및 저온 공정으로 기존의 실리콘 태양전지를 대체할 수 있는 장점들이 있다. 기존의 경험적 방법으로 예측한 광흡수층 박막을 최적화하기 위해서 소자 특성 평가를 통해 신뢰도를 검증해야 한다. 그러나 광흡수층 박막 소자 특성 평가 비용이 많이 소요되므로 시험 횟수에 제약이 따른다. 이러한 문제점을 해결하기 위하여 광흡수층 박막 최적화의 보조 수단으로 머신러닝이나 인공지능 모델을 이용하여 명확하고 타당한 모델의 개발과 적용 가능성이 무한하다고 본다. 이 연구에서는 페로브스카이트 태양전지의 광 흡수층 박막 최적화를 추정하기 위하여 서포트 벡터 머신의 선형 커널, 가우시안 커널, 비선형 다항식 커널, 시그모이드 커널의 회귀분석 모델을 비교하여 커널 함수별 정확도 차이를 검증하였다.

특성맵 차분을 활용한 커널 기반 비디오 프레임 보간 기법 (Kernel-Based Video Frame Interpolation Techniques Using Feature Map Differencing)

  • 서동혁;고민성;이승학;박종혁
    • 정보처리학회논문지:소프트웨어 및 데이터공학
    • /
    • 제13권1호
    • /
    • pp.17-27
    • /
    • 2024
  • 비디오 프레임 보간(Video Frame Interpolation)은 움직임의 연속성을 증가시켜 영상을 부드럽게 재생할 수 있어 영상, 미디어 분야에서 사용되는 중요한 기술이다. 딥러닝 기반 비디오 프레임 보간 연구에서 널리 사용되는 방법 중 하나인 커널 기반 방법(Kernel Based Method)의 경우, 지역적인 변화를 잘 포착하지만 전체적인 변화를 처리하는 데 한계가 있었다. 이에 본 논문에서는 주요 변화 포착에 집중하기 위한 특성맵 차분, Two Direction을 적용한 새로운 U-Net 구조를 통해 파라미터 수를 줄이면서 중간 프레임을 보다 정확하게 생성하고자 한다. 실험 결과 제안한 구조가 기존보다 Vimeo, Middle-burry 등의 일반적인 데이터셋과 새로운 YouTube 데이터셋에서 기존 모델보다 약 61% 더 적은 파라미터로 PSNR 수치가 최대 0.3 우수한 성능을 달성하였다. 본 논문에서 사용한 코드는 https://github.com/Go-MinSeong/SF-AdaCoF에서 확인 가능하다.

레벨셋과 무요소법을 결합한 위상 및 형상 최적설계 (Level Set Based Topological Shape Optimization Combined with Meshfree Method)

  • 안승호;하승현;조선호
    • 한국전산구조공학회논문집
    • /
    • 제27권1호
    • /
    • pp.1-8
    • /
    • 2014
  • 레벨셋 기법과 무요소법을 결합한 위상 및 형상 최적설계 기법을 개발하여 선형 탄성문제에 적용하였다. 설계민감도는 애드조인트법을 사용하여 효율적으로 구하였다. 해밀턴-자코비 방정식을 업-윈드 기법을 이용하여 수치적으로 풀었으며, 구조물의 경계는 레벨셋 함수를 이용하여 암시적으로 표현하였다. 구조물의 응답과 설계민감도를 얻기 위하여 암시적 함수를 사용하여 명시적 경계를 생성하였다. 재생 커널 기법에 기초하여 얻어진 전역 절점 기저함수를 사용하여 연속체 지배방정식의 변위장을 이산화하였다. 따라서 질점들을 연속체 영역의 어느 곳이든 위치시킬 수 있으며, 이는 통해 명시적 경계를 생성하는 것이 가능하며, 결과적으로 정확한 설계를 얻을 수 있다. 개발된 방법은 제한 조건이 있는 최적설계 문제에 대하여 라그랑지안 범함수를 정의한다. 이는 경계의 변화를 통하여 허용 부피 제한조건을 만족시키면서 컴플라이언스를 최소화한다. 최적설계 과정 동안 라그랑지안 범함수의 최적화조건을 만족시킴으로써 해밀턴-자코비 방정식을 풀기 위한 속도장을 얻는다. 기존의 형상 최적설계 기법에 비하여, 본 방법론은 위상과 형상의 변화를 쉽게 얻어낼 수 있다.

JVM 기반 스마트폰의 실시간성 지원 구조 (Implementation of Real-time Support in JVM-based Smartphone System)

  • 우영주;조정욱;서의성
    • 한국정보과학회:학술대회논문집
    • /
    • 한국정보과학회 2011년도 한국컴퓨터종합학술대회논문집 Vol.38 No.1(A)
    • /
    • pp.506-509
    • /
    • 2011
  • Android는 스마트폰 시스템에서 사용되는 소프트웨어 플랫폼으로 JVM(Java Virtual Machine)을 기반으로 한다. JVM은 실시간성 지원을 고려하지 않은 기술이며 이를 기반으로 한 Android 또한 실시간성을 지원하기 위한 어떠한 방법도 가지고 있지 않다. 스마트폰 시스템을 통해 QoS를 보장하면서 멀티미디어 서비스를 제공하기 위해서는 JVM 기반의 시스템을 위한 실시간성 향상 기술이 필요하다. 본 연구에서는 기존의 안드로이드 시스템에 리눅스에서 제공하는 실시간 보장기능을 적용할 수 있도록 지원하는 크로스 레이어 구조를 제안한다. 이 구조를 통해 우리는 리눅스 커널에 존재하는 실시간 스케줄러를 사용하여 태스크가 실시간으로 실행될 수 있도록 지원한다. 또한 다양한 목적을 가진 어플리케이션이 공존하는 스마트폰 시스템에서 실시간성을 요구하는 어플리케이션에 대해 차별적으로 실시간성을 보장할 수 있다. 소프트 리얼타임 특성을 가지는 멀티미디어 태스크를 실시간 태스크로 실행하고 실제 스마트폰에서 실행시켰을 때 시스템에 높은 부하가 걸릴 때에도 합리적인 실시간 보장성을 얻을 수 있다. 음악을 재생한 실험에서는 1200개의 프로세스가 백그라운드 태스크로 실행되는 상황에서도 끊김을 느낄 수 없을 정도로 QoS를 보장성이 높은것을 확인 하였다. 본 연구에서 제안하는 실시간성 지원을 위한 크로스 레이어를 통해 스마트폰은 낮은 비용으로 기존의 어플리케이션을 변경하지 않으면서 실시간 특성을 지원할 수 있다.